Check alle échte Black Friday-deals Ook zo moe van nepaanbiedingen? Wij laten alleen échte deals zien

[ASP.NET] Image weergeven zonder lokaal path

Pagina: 1
Acties:
  • 222 views

  • SiXke
  • Registratie: September 2003
  • Laatst online: 27-11 20:15
Hallo

Ik wil images die op mijn server staan weergeven op mijn asp site, zonder deze image directories open te maken voor iedereen.

Kan asp bv een image die op D:\images\1.jpg staat laten weer geven als gewoon 1.jpg?

Een soort tijdelijke cache van deze images zonder de originele map bereikbaar te maken.

Ik heb al gegoogled, maar niet direct iets gevonden, misschien kan dit gewoon niet?

Grtz

  • creator1988
  • Registratie: Januari 2007
  • Laatst online: 29-11 10:10
Ja, een Virtual Directory met de naam 'images' aanmaken in IIS. Deze wijst naar D:\Images. Dan kan je in asp gewoon <img src="1.jpg"/> doen.

[ Voor 72% gewijzigd door creator1988 op 30-11-2010 13:43 ]


  • Noordamski
  • Registratie: Oktober 2002
  • Laatst online: 17-01 14:23

Noordamski

yibbedi yibbeda

Maak bijv. een image.asp(x) en geef via de querystring door om welke afbeelding het gaat. Lees daarmee het juiste bestand uit op de server. De inhoud van de afbeelding met een response weer naar de browser sturen. Vergeet niet voordat je de response stuurt de juiste header(s) te sturen zodat de browser krijgt wat er verwacht wordt.
Hier moet je op google ver mee kunnen komen.

If you can't convince them with facts, dazzle them with bullshit


  • TeeDee
  • Registratie: Februari 2001
  • Laatst online: 00:01

TeeDee

CQB 241

creator1988 schreef op dinsdag 30 november 2010 @ 13:42:
Ja, een Virtual Directory met de naam 'images' aanmaken in IIS. Deze wijst naar D:\Images. Dan kan je in asp gewoon <img src="1.jpg"/> doen.
Uhm, volgens mij zal je dan iets als <img src="/images/1.jpg" /> moeten doen. Direct gevolg is dat (mits directory browsing uitstaat) men gewoon bij die directory kan.

Je zou bijvoorbeeld ook iets als <img src="image.ashx?path=1.jpg" /> kunnen maken. Waarbij je image.ashx intern de afbeelding binnen trekt op basis van de querystring.

Heart..pumps blood.Has nothing to do with emotion! Bored


  • Matis
  • Registratie: Januari 2007
  • Laatst online: 18:26

Matis

Rubber Rocket

TeeDee schreef op dinsdag 30 november 2010 @ 13:47:
Je zou bijvoorbeeld ook iets als <img src="image.ashx?path=1.jpg" /> kunnen maken. Waarbij je image.ashx intern de afbeelding binnen trekt op basis van de querystring.
Dat geniet ook mijn voorkeur.
Zo doe ik het eigenlijk ook altijd met PHP/GD

If money talks then I'm a mime
If time is money then I'm out of time


  • Grijze Vos
  • Registratie: December 2002
  • Laatst online: 28-02 22:17
Noordamski schreef op dinsdag 30 november 2010 @ 13:45:
Maak bijv. een image.asp(x) en geef via de querystring door om welke afbeelding het gaat. Lees daarmee het juiste bestand uit op de server. De inhoud van de afbeelding met een response weer naar de browser sturen. Vergeet niet voordat je de response stuurt de juiste header(s) te sturen zodat de browser krijgt wat er verwacht wordt.
Hier moet je op google ver mee kunnen komen.
Een aspx? Nee, gebruik dan in ieder geval een eigengemaakte handler. Een page handler (aspx) heeft ontzettend veel overhead t.o.v. een reguliere handler. Dit is performance killer zodra je begint te schalen in pageviews.

Op zoek naar een nieuwe collega, .NET webdev, voornamelijk productontwikkeling. DM voor meer info


  • RobIII
  • Registratie: December 2001
  • Niet online

RobIII

Admin Devschuur®

^ Romeinse Ⅲ ja!

(overleden)
Wat was er niet duidelijk aan RobIII in "\[ASP.NET] Lokale images op server" :?

"Ik heb gegoogled" roepen maakt je topic niet opeens wél goed.

There are only two hard problems in distributed systems: 2. Exactly-once delivery 1. Guaranteed order of messages 2. Exactly-once delivery.

Je eigen tweaker.me redirect

Over mij

Pagina: 1

Dit topic is gesloten.